Hello, We're using the bootstrap version of the appointments form and choosing 800px width, scroll_off to true, and layout_cols to 2. However, it's not showing up as two columns. What are the common solutions for this?

I had the same problem, but I discovered how to solve it.
When you copy the shortcode from the manual page and paste it in your WP page, the last quotes are styled quotes. If you replace them by the ” of your keyboard the 2 columns are behaving as expected.

Hi, there are some overlap inside styles. Can you set for shortcode width attribute 100% and go to EA Settings > Customize page and in custom styles place this :
@media (min-width: 992px) {
	.ea-bootstrap .col-md-6 {
    	width: 45%;
	}
}
save settings and refresh the page :) Best regards, Nikola
